Nutritional Content of Wendy's Chili

Each serving of Wendy's chili (10 oz) contains the following:

  • Calories: 170
  • Total Fat: 5 g
  • Saturated Fat: 2 g
  • Trans Fat: 0 g
  • Cholesterol: 25 mg
  • Sodium: 830 mg
  • Total Carbohydrates: 19 g
  • Dietary Fiber: 5 g
  • Total Sugars: 6 g
  • Protein: 14 g

Pros of Eating Wendy's Chili

There are a few benefits of including Wendy's chili in your diet:

  • Good source of protein - Wendy's chili contains 14 g of protein per serving, which can help you feel full and satisfied.
  • High in fiber - With 5 g of dietary fiber per serving, Wendy's chili can help keep your digestive system healthy.
  • Low in calories - At just 170 calories per serving, Wendy's chili can be a good option for those watching their calorie intake.

Cons of Eating Wendy's Chili

There are a few drawbacks to consider when eating Wendy's chili:

  • High in sodium - One serving of Wendy's chili contains 830 mg of sodium, which is about a third of the recommended daily value. Consuming too much sodium can increase your risk of high blood pressure and heart disease.
  • High in sugar - Wendy's chili contains 6 g of sugar per serving, which may be a concern for those with diabetes or watching their sugar intake.
  • Potential for added fats and calories - Wendy's chili is typically served with toppings such as cheese and crackers, which can add additional calories and fats to your meal.

FAQs

Is Wendy's chili gluten-free?

Yes, Wendy's chili does not contain gluten.

Is Wendy's chili vegan or vegetarian?

No, Wendy's chili contains ground beef and is not suitable for vegetarians or vegans.

Is Wendy's chili keto-friendly?

Wendy's chili is relatively low in carbs, with 19 g of total carbohydrates per serving. However, it is still relatively high in sodium and may not be the best option for those following a strict keto diet.

Can I eat Wendy's chili on a diet?

Wendy's chili can be a good option for those watching their calorie intake, as it is relatively low in calories. However, it is important to be mindful of the sodium and sugar content of the chili, as well as any toppings that may be added.

Is Wendy's chili healthy?

The answer to this question depends on your individual health goals and dietary restrictions. While Wendy's chili is a good source of protein and fiber, it is also high in sodium and sugar. It is important to consider the overall nutritional content of the chili, as well as any potential added fats and calories from toppings.
